FIND OUR CACHE
Ready to try geocaching? The Adventure Guys have stashed two caches around the South Sound area to get you started. Plug in the coordinates below into your GPS receiver and go find them. Sign the log book and, if you choose, record your find at Geocaching.com. Those who sign the register will be entered in a drawing for a prize. We’ll announce the winners on The Adventure Guys blog on Nov. 13.
